  • The capillary tube and short tube orifice have been widely used as an expansion device in the refrigeration and air-conditioning system. To improve the system performance, expansion devices need to be optimized with the components of a refrigeration system. In the present study, a numerical model for a capillary, which could predict the flow rate and properties along a tube, was developed by assuming homogeneous two-phase flow. A semi-empirical flow model for evaluation of the flow rate through a short tube orifice was also developed by using the experimental data. Finally, the results of the numerical model for a capillary was compared with those of the semi-empirical model for a short tube orifice to identify the dominant flow factors for the expansion devices.

  • A general flow distribution model and a simple process of numerical analysis, which can be applied to multi-pass systems with manifolds, are presented. A numerical procedure, namely a modified equal pressure method based on the discrete model, was developed to predict flow rates at branch tubes. The predicted pressure distribution agreed well with the previous research with the average error less than 11%. A parametric study was performed to demonstrate the effect on the flow distribution.

  • The fretting wear behaviour of Zircaloy-4 tube used as the fuel rod cladding in PWR nuclear power plants has been investigated at the different test environment, in light water and in air as a function of slip amplitude, normal load, test duration and frequency. Zircaloy-4 tubes were used for both of oscillating and stationary specimens. A fretting wear tester was designed to be suitable for this fretting test. The wear volume and specific wear rate of Zircaloy-4 tube in water was greater than those in air under various slip amplitude. Delaminates and surface cracks were observed at low slip amplitude and high load of fretting test in water, but the traces of adhesion and plowing were observed at and above 200 Um. The water accelerates the wear of Zircaloy-4 tube at lower slip amplitude in fretting.

  • The present work presents condensation heat transfer and pressure drop data for the flow of R-12 in flat extruded aluminum tubes with small hydraulic diameters. The tube outside dimensions are $18mm(width){\times}1.7mm(height)$. Three types of internal geometry with the same outside dimensions are tested : sample 1 (7 tube holes), sample 2 (13 tube holes) and sample 3 (7 tube holes, micro-fin). The overall heat transfer coefficient is obtained for air-to-refrigerant heat transfer, and the Wilson plot method is used to determine the heat transfer coefficient for refrigerant flow. The sample 2 and sample 3 show significantly higher performance than sample 1. The heat transfer rates for the sample 2 and sample 3 are 9% and 12% higher, respectively, than sample 1. The friction factors for the sample 2 and sample 3 are 11.9% and 2.4% higher, respectively, than sample 1.

  • Transcritical$CO_2$ systems are under consideration for use as residential/mobile air conditioners. In these systems, an internal heat exchanger is usually adopted to improve both capacity and/or COP of the $CO_2$ system in lower operating pressure range of gas cooler. A program has been developed to analyse the performance of internal heat exchangers using the section-by-section method. The internal heat exchanger of coaxial configuration is first analyzed and fairly good agreements with the data are obtained, And then the internal heat exchanger of multiple circular coil configuration has been investigated. The results obtained from the parametric study provide the guidelines for the initial design and manufacturing concepts of the internal heat exchanger in transcritical $CO_2$ system. Further studies are necessary to develop the heat transfer correlations of carbon dioxide in the tubes to obtain more accurate results.

  • Frequency of cavity vibration in air flowing tube is closely related to a velocity of air. In this research, an instrumentation system to estimate frequency of cavity vibration for measurement of the velocity and quantity of a moving fluid is implemented by using DSP TMS320C32. Measurement of the generated sound wave frequency in cavity is difficult because of environmental noise. Adaptive filters are used to eliminate this noise effectively. The estimated velocity and quantity of a moving fluid by proposed system is compared with the results measured by a standard flow meter.
